They have a better write up on our coaching search than any other one that I have seen. To sum it up....According to Nardozzi he has had no conversations with Akron about the job. He said that he has been on the road recruiting. Spartanmag suggests that Akron will be speaking with him this week because their sources suggest that Akron wants to make a hire by next week. Michigan State is extremely worried about losing him. He has been the most successful d coordinator that they have had. He is considered their best recruiter. He is also the lead recruiter in New Jersey, NE Ohio and parts of Michigan. Narduzzi is currently making $233k, but they suggest that his pay is about to be increased to $290k. They are hearing that Akron will be paying in the $400k range. It doesn't sound like he is in that big of a rush to be a head coach, so who know? Quote
